THE ORGANISER of a vegan festival said the day was ‘absolutely fantastic’.
The sixth annual event took over Market Place and Broad Street on Saturday for a day of food and fun.
It was opened by Peter Egan, an actor famous for several big roles including Downtown Abbey. He is also an animal rights activist.
The event saw more than 50 stalls take part, offering a wide range of vegan foods, ethical products and gifts, showcasing everything about a meat-free lifestyle.
There was also a programme of talks and workshops, including a set from comedian Carl Donnelly, which took place in The Market House.

Children had their own activities including face painting, craft workshops and story times.
Sarah Zeneli, from Sparkle Vegan Events, was thrilled with the day.
“It went really, really well, we saw thousands of people attending,” she said. “There were lots of comments from people saying they were enjoying the atmosphere and the variety of stalls on offer.
“Some of the stalls sold out – the vegan cheese stall was one. Some stallholders told me it was the best day they’d ever had.”
Ms Zeneli said she had had good feedback about the extension of the festival into Broad Street. “They were excited to see the festival go on,” she said.
Peter Egan was a great guest, she added. “People were happy to meet him. He also took his time to visit the stalls, as did the mayor who enjoyed trying something new.”

Every year, Ms Zeneli said, the festival grows – “it beats my expectations” – and she is now looking ahead to the Forbury Vegan Fiesta, which will take place in April. Before then, there is the monthly vegan market in Wokingham.
So why does she think there is a growth in attendance?
“More people are trying it, know someone who is vegan, or want to cut down on their meat or dairy consumption,” she explains. “It has an environmental impact, and an impact on their health as well.
“People also want to try something new and support small businesses.”
